The heater is extremely energy efficient. Its diathermic oils can warm your room quickly. This oil-filled heater is made from a body of metal coated with an exclusive ceramic insulation layer. When the heating element of the electric is turned on, the heat is transferred to the liquid, which then conducts it around the internal fins of the radiator. The air is then heated through the convection process, creating an inviting, warm atmosphere. Typically, they are constructed from metal columns with grooves or cavities that permit the thermal oil to circulate freely. The heating element in the electrical circuit heats the thermal oil, which then transmits warmth to the surrounding area via air convection and radiation.
